DA6011 Highly integrated power and clock supply IC
for new generation Intel Atom processor
General Description
The DA6011 is a single chip power management and clock companion IC for the Intel®
Atom™ processor E6xx series (formerly codenamed Tunnel Creek). The single chip
solution provides all power and clock supplies as well as system management control.
It is designed to support platforms based on the Intel Atom processor E6xx series,
including the IO-hubs.
Integrated power management
Dialog Semiconductor’s new DA6011 uses a single supply voltage and provides low noise supplies to all CPU and IO-Hub voltage domains with current
management for the system DDR2 and boot SPI flash memory.
The DA6011 integrates 11 high performance low dropout (LDO) voltage regulators, which use Dialog’s patented Smart Mirror™ technology for very low
quiescent current, and includes 3 pass devices for platform power distribution simplification.
Six DC-DC buck converters (three with external FETs and three with integrated FETs) provide current to the Intel Atom E6xx series platform’s multiple low
voltage domains. These highly efficient buck converters supply the CPU and graphics core and meet Intel IMVP-6 specification. Furthermore, they power
the system memories, the IO-hub and further high current loads of the platform.
The power domain architecture has been carefully optimised to deliver enhanced power efficiency to the platform at the lowest power dissipation, thereby
maximising battery life and reducing thermal impact. The architecture also takes several IO-hubs with its different power requirements into account.
Systsem Manager Controller
The integrated system management controller takes care of the complete platform start-up, state-transitioning and power-down procedures. It
operates autonomously and reduces the overall system power consumption when entering stand-by or power down modes.
The flexible state-machine implementation is designed to control Intel Atom processor E6xx series based platforms including the Intel Platform
Control Hub EG20T, OKI Semiconductor ML7223 / ML7213 and ST Microelectronics ConneXt STA2X11 IO-hubs.

Operating conditions
An analogue to digital converter (ADC) with 10bit resolution
combined with an input multiplexer and track and hold circuitry
has been implemented.
Designed with AEC-Q100 specifications in mind, the DA6011 operates
between -40 and +85°C to meet industrial and automotive
temperature ranges.
Two inputs can be used to measure signals manually or automatically.
The die temperature and the output currents of each source will be
monitored to ensure proper and safe operation.
